About two-thirds of adults with diabetes have blood pressure greater than 130/80 mm Hg or use prescription ... WebJan 18, 2024 · Clinically, pain can lead to increased blood pressure. Common causes such as abdominal pain, pain caused by lumbar disc herniation, and pain caused by femoral neck fracture can lead to increased blood pressure, which will return to normal after pain relief.
